The Swiss Federal Department of Foreign Affairs (FDFA) yesterday handed to the German Embassy in Bern a series of bank documents that could shed light on the existence of possible misappropriated assets of parties and people’s organisations from former East Germany. The Federal Council made the decision to transfer the documents to Germany at its meeting on 30 June 2010. Germany had previously asked Switzerland for the documents in order to obtain further information about illegal financial movements before and after the fall of the Berlin Wall. The accounts that were found had been closed several years ago. At the time of closure, they did not hold any assets.

In the last five years 370'000 people have gained access to drinking water as a result of Swiss support. In Tanzania, where Switzerland is strongly committed in the health-care sector, child mortality has fallen by 40% in the last ten years. These and other results are presented in the Annual Report on Switzerland’s International Cooperation. In 2009, Switzerland channelled 0.47% of its gross national income to Official development assistance, placing it in the mid-range of OECD donor countries.

At its meeting on 22 May 2024, the Federal Council adopted the Dispatch on the International Cooperation Strategy 2025–28 (IC Strategy 2025–28). The dispatch outlines the objectives and priorities of Switzerland's international cooperation for the next four years and proposes them to Parliament for approval. The IC Strategy 2025–28 provides for a budget of CHF 11.27 billion over four years. In light of an ever-changing world, the strategy pursues long-term objectives – combating poverty and promoting sustainable development – while maintaining a high degree of flexibility to respond to the many current crises.

At its meeting on 15 May 2024, the Federal Council took note of the eighth annual report on the implementation of the Federal Act on Private Security Services Provided Abroad (PSSA). The Act requires companies intending to offer private security services abroad from Switzerland to declare the services to the competent authority in advance. In 2023, the FDFA received 95 declarations from companies. No activities were prohibited.

At its meeting on 8 May 2024, the Federal Council decided to make a contribution of CHF 10 million to the humanitarian aid appeal of the United Nations Relief and Works Agency for Palestine Refugees in the Near East (UNRWA). The CHF 10 million contribution is exclusively earmarked for Gaza and will be used to provide the urgent assistance specified in the UNRWA Flash Appeal for the occupied Palestinian territory covering the period April–December 2024. In its overall assessment, the Federal Council drew on the analysis of the Colonna report and coordination with other donors. The Federal Council will submit this decision to the foreign affairs committees of the National Council and Council of States for consultation.

At its meeting on 20 December 2019, the Federal Council approved an exchange of notes between Switzerland and Italy regarding the change of the customs status of the Italian enclave of Campione d'Italia. This exchange of notes is necessary to ensure legal certainty and facilitates the transition of Campione d'Italia into the European Union's customs territory, scheduled for 1 January 2020.
